Jai Mata Glass Ltd is a leading manufacturer of designer glass products, including rolled, figured, and wired glass. It also produces lead crystal glassware, marking its footprint in both industrial and decorative glass segments. The company significantly expanded its manufacturing capacity in 2007, enhancing its rolled, figured, and wired glass production to 8.77 million square meters per annum. In addition to manufacturing, Jai Mata Glass Ltd has taken strategic steps to diversify and expand into selling glass products, suggesting a focus on broader market participation. With a history dating back to 1981, Jai Mata Glass Ltd has established itself as a prominent player in the glass industry, driven by its continuous capacity expansions and diversification efforts.
